1. Traffic lights are divided into red, green and yellow light.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

2. How far should be the distance from the vehicle in front at the speed of more than 100 km/hr when driving a small passenger vehicle on the expressway?

A. more than 50 meters

B. more than 60 meters

C. more than 100 meters

D. more than 80 meters

Answer: C

3. You may not use the turn signal when you change to the right lane.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

4. Driving in a dusty weather, it does not needed to turn on the head light, the contour light and the tail light.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

5. What is the max speed on the expressway when the visibility is lower than 100 meters?

A. less than 40km/hr

B. less than 60km/hr

C. less than 80km/hr

D. less than 90km/hr

Answer: A

7. Whats the role of directional sign?

A. restrict the vehicles from passing

B. indicate speed limited information

C. provide direction information

D. warn danger ahead

Answer: C

9. This sign reminds the lane for non-motorized vehicles ahead.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

10. Before a vehicle enters an intersection, the driver should reduce speed, observe and make sure it is safe to do so.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

11. Which of the following vehicle in front in the same lane is not allowed to be overtaken?

A. police car on duty

B. large bus or large truck

C. taxis

D. public bus

Answer: A

13. The continuously flashing yellow light means that the vehicle may speed up and pass.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

14. When driving a vehicle through an inundated road with non-motorized vehicles on both sides, the driver should _________.

A. Reduce speed and go slowly

B. Go forward normally

C. Speed up and pass

D. Continuously honk

Answer: A

15. When a motorized vehicle causes a minor traffic accident and obstructs traffic flow, it does not need to move.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

16. Which is subject to a 12-point penalty?

A. driving a motorized vehicle when driving license is temporarily detained

B. applying for reissuing the driving license by concealment or deception

C. not yielding to the school bus according to regulations

D. running with the license plate deliberately stained

Answer: D

19. When the driver senses a tire blowout on the road, he should control the direction of the vehicle, gently depress the brake pedal to slowly reduce the speed and gradually park the vehicle steadily on the roadside.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

20. The double yellow solid lines in the middle of the road are used to separate the traffic flow in opposite directions, crossing the lines to overtake or make a turn is allowed if it is safe.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B
